About Clarins
In 1954, Jacques Courtin-Clarins opened his first beauty spa in Paris with the intention of making beauty more real and natural. He did so by experimenting with essential oils, drawing from natural plant extracts, and innovating on their application methods. His first breakthrough was a massage oil that increased the effectiveness of skin-firming massages. The product was so popular that he began selling it, thus beginning his foray into the skincare industry as the Clarins group.
One of Jacques’s greatest achievements occurred in 1985, when he challenged a chemical engineer to solve a problem: how to deliver two anti-aging serums—one soluble in water and the other soluble in oil—in a single treatment. The result was Double Serum, two separate treatment bottles that customers mix together to preserve the active ingredients. Today, Clarins continues to produce high-end products designed to accentuate and preserve natural beauty, from anti-aging creams and cleansers to makeup and perfumes.
